Zelenskyy Discusses Defense Cooperation with Lockheed Martin
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y met with representatives from the defense company Lockheed Martin to discuss the development of cooperation between the two entities. The discussions focused on potential joint production initiatives and the exchange of advanced technologies. This meeting underscores Ukraine's ongoing efforts to strengthen its defense capabilities through strategic partnerships with major international defense contractors. The engagement with Lockheed Martin, a prominent player in the global aerospace and defense industry, signals a commitment to enhancing Ukraine's military-industrial complex. Further collaboration could involve the transfer of critical technologies and the establishment of manufacturing capabilities within Ukraine. The talks are expected to pave the way for future joint projects aimed at bolstering Ukraine's security and defense readiness.
